Mission

To advance state policies that improve the economic mobility and quality of life for all floridians

Programs

1 program

The florida policy summit brought together 188 partners from across the state, including leading policy experts, grassroots organizers, community advocates, foundations, educators, students and community members, to celebrate their collective impact and envision an equitable future for florida. The summit featured thought-provoking panel discussions and breakout sessions, highlighting themes like the intersection of policy advocacy and coalition building, leveraging creative communications strategies and building equitable narratives.

Expenses: $103K
